
Arrest in 14-Year-Old Texas Cold Case of Woman Stabbed Nearly 100 Times
After fourteen years, law enforcement officials in Arlington, Texas, have arrested Mayra Velasquez for the 2012 brutal killing of Irasema Chavez. The victim was discovered in her home with nearly 100 stab wounds, but the investigation stalled for over a decade due to a lack of direct matches in traditional DNA databases. Authorities finally identified Velasquez, a local real estate agent, by using investigative genetic genealogy to link crime scene DNA to her distant relatives.
